Solution for What is 45 percent of 1150:

45 percent *1150 =

(45:100)*1150 =

(45*1150):100 =

51750:100 = 517.5

Now we have: 45 percent of 1150 = 517.5

Question: What is 45 percent of 1150?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: Our output value is 1150.

Step 2: We represent the unknown value with {x}.

Step 3: From step 1 above,{1150}={100\%}.

Step 4: Similarly, {x}={45\%}.

Step 5: This results in a pair of simple equations:

{1150}={100\%}(1).

{x}={45\%}(2).

Step 6: By dividing equation 1 by equation 2 and noting that both the RHS (right hand side) of both
equations have the same unit (%); we have

\frac{1150}{x}=\frac{100\%}{45\%}

Step 7: Again, the reciprocal of both sides gives

\frac{x}{1150}=\frac{45}{100}

\Rightarrow{x} = {517.5}

Therefore, {45\%} of {1150} is {517.5}
